THE INFLUENCE OF DIFFERENT TYPES OF MESODEFECTS ON THE FORMATION OF STRAIN INDUCED BROKEN DISLOCATION BOUNDARIES AT THE FACETED GRAIN BOUNDARY
Materials Physics and Mechanics. 2018. Vol. 38. P. 33-39.
Kirikov S., Svirina Y.
In this paper we analyze mesodefects accumulating during plastic deformation on the faceted high angle grain boundaries. It is shown that the system of mesodefects can be represented as a set of linear mesodefects of the rotational type (junction disclinations), and planar mesodefects of the shear type (uniformly distributed dislocations with Burgers vector lying in the plane of the facet). Martynov Y., Nazmitdinov R., Moia-Pol A. et al., Physical Chemistry Chemical Physics 2017 Vol. 19 No. 30 P. 19916-19921
Organometal triiodide perovskites are promising, high-performance absorbers in solar cells. Considering the perovskite as a thin film absorber, we solve transport equations and analyse the efficiency of a simple heterojunction configuration as a function of electron–hole diffusion lengths. We found that for a thin film thickness of ~1 micron the maximum efficiency of ~31% could ...

Visco S., Nimon V. Y., Petrov A. et al., Journal of Solid State Electrochemistry 2014 Vol. 18 No. 5 P. 1443-1456
Abstract The extremely high theoretical energy density of the lithium-oxygen couple makes it very attractive for next-generation battery development. However, there are a number of challenging technical hurdles that must be addressed for Li-Air batteries to become a commercial reality. In this article, we demonstrate how the invention of water-stable, solid electrolyte-protected lithium electrodes solves ...
